Q: What is a Car Seat to Stroller?
A: It is a car seat that turns into a stroller. You can move your baby easily from the car to a walk. It is a super convenient option for busy parents.
Key Features to Look For
When choosing a car seat to stroller, think about what matters most.
- Ease of Use: Look for a system that folds and unfolds easily. You do not want a complicated system when you are tired.
- Weight Capacity: Make sure the car seat and stroller can handle your baby’s weight as they grow. Check the maximum weight limit.
- Safety Standards: The car seat must meet safety standards. Look for certifications from organizations like the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A).
- Maneuverability: The stroller should be easy to push and steer. Good wheels make a big difference.
- Storage: Think about how much storage you need. Some strollers have big baskets. Others have smaller ones.
Q: What kind of wheels should it have?
A: Look for wheels that swivel. They make turning easier. Bigger wheels are better for bumpy roads.
Important Materials
The materials used in a car seat to stroller affect its safety and comfort.
- Frame: The frame is usually made of metal, like aluminum. Aluminum is strong and lightweight.
- Fabric: The fabric should be soft and easy to clean. Look for fabrics that are breathable. This keeps your baby cool.
- Harness: The harness secures the baby in the car seat. Make sure it is adjustable and easy to use.
- Wheels: Wheels are often made of rubber or plastic. Rubber wheels provide a smoother ride.

Q: How does it compare to a travel system?
A: A travel system is a car seat and a separate stroller. A car seat to stroller is all-in-one. Both are good options, but the car seat to stroller is more compact.
